What are two theories that scientists believe are the reasons for the increases in temperature

Geography
1 answer:
TiliK225 [7]3 years ago
6 0

Answer:

1)Climate change is happening. It's caused primarily by the burning of oil, gas, and coal.

2) Evidence for global warming !! Most scientists agree that the Earth's climate is getting warmer. This is called global warming. Most, but not all, scientists believe that the cause of this is an increased amount of carbon dioxide in the atmosphere due to human activities.
